Liquid adhesion is the principle of physics that explains how as liquids flow they adhere to the surface across which they are traveling.
A miter is the fastener that connects two gutter sections on a corner.
A joint in a long run of cladding gutter or flashing designed to allow for thermal expansion and contraction.
In gutters liquid adhesion is seen as water is corralled into a gutter over a surface.
The leafguard gutter system is based on the principle of liquid adhesion.
Downspout a vertical enclosed pipe which is attached to the side of the home.
A system of gutters and downspouts designed to carry water away from the house drip edge extension.
Drainage a system of gutters and drainpipes that carry water away from the foundation of a house.

The elbow on a gutter system is the piece that connects to the end of the downspout so water can efficiently drain away.

Pipe cleats are the fasteners that connect the downspout to the side of your home.
